RS PRO Hermetic Enclosure, IP67 Rating


This RS PRO Hermetic Enclosure is designed for applications requiring a secure and hermetically sealed environment. Ideal for protecting sensitive equipment, it offers robust protection against liquids and solid objects with an IP67 rating. The enclosure is made from durable polycarbonate, ensuring long-lasting performance.
